Join the U.S. Department of State’s Bureau of Overseas Buildings Operations (OBO) as a global Facility Manager. Our 225+ Facility Managers located throughout the world keep U.S. Embassies and Consulates maintained and fully operational. Foreign Service Facility Managers are the professional facilities, technical, and operations experts at U.S. diplomatic missions and they support OBO’s mission to provide safe, secure, functional, and resilient facilities abroad.

Job Requirements

  • Bachelor’s Degree with 3 years of Specialized Experience OR a Master’s Degree with 2 years of Specialized Experience, OR a Bachelor’s Degree in Facility Management or Facilities Engineering with no experience (please refer to the vacancy announcement for a description of specialized experience. Experience may not be substituted for education.)

Applicants must be U.S. citizens. By law, all career candidates must be appointed to the Foreign Service prior to the month in which they reach age 60, except for preference-eligible veterans. Applicants must also be available for worldwide service and be able to obtain all required security, medical, and suitability clearances.
